שלום לכולם ,
בעיה שמציקה לכולנו בחלק מהדוחות היא שכשפותחים את ה-SLICER רואים המון MEMBERS שיוצרים קבוצות ריקות בחיבור עם SLICER אחרים.
ניסיתי לשחק קצת עם זה ומצאתי PROPERTY נחמד בSLICER->PROPERTIES->ADVANCED שנקרא : show only non empty members.
הFEATURE עובד מצויין על קוביות פשוטות (ממה שאני רואה עד כה ) אבל הוא לא עובד טוב על קוביות וירטואליות.
(אצלי יש לי מודל מדדים ויעדים שמורכב מ-2 קוביות פשוטות וקובייה וירטואלית שמשלבת ביניהן וזה עובד רק על הקובייה הפשוטה , למרות שהקובייה הוירטואלית מכילה את כל המימדים + כל המדדים של הקובייה הפשוטה.... )
מישהו יודע איך אפשר לעקוף את הבעיה (או שלא ולפחות אני אפסיק לשחק אם זה .. )
להלן הפתרון , עושה רושם שיש התנגשות בין התכונה הנ"ל , ובין תכונה מתקדמת במאפיינים של הדוח,
כדאי להיכנס ל properties (table/ report) -> advanced -> optimize huge crossjoins
ותחתיו לבחור את המדד שלפיו בודים האם MEMBER הוא EMPTY או לא.
נבדק ועובד פצצות
(אני לא יודע מה איתכם אב אצלי משתמשים מתלוננים הרבה פעמים על זה שיש אלפי MEMBERS לבחירה בSLICERS שיוצרים קבוצות ריקות וממש לא בא למשתמשים העצלים לשים את המימד על הGRID )
כמובן שיש חסרונות (שימוש ב-CALCULATED MEMBERS אני חושב שלא אפשרי , אבל זו כבר בעיה אחרת )